StarViper's problem was they were part of the initial S&V release.
There was a lot of caution in their designs of the time, and (if we're being frank) a certain lack of niche analysis tied up with too much hype (Its not like they actually stuck to the "Oh, Scum has lower PS than the others" vibe anyway - we've got a Wedge and a Han now, and they're both PS9...)
Were it being released now, I bet it'd look an awful lot more like a 3-attack TAP, and Guri and Xizor's abilities would be all the more relevant for it as a method of shoring up defense on an ace fighter.

You can use your predator to reroll a hit/crit hoping for blanks/eyeballs. Say you roll hit and three blanks. Rather than risking your opponent's green dice, you can use predator on your hit hoping for a miss giving you a higher chance of triggering IG88B's gunner ability.

This has been my Bots build for the past few months;
IG88B; Wired, HLC, FCS, AT, ID, IG2000
IG88D: Wired, HLC, FCS, AT, ID, IG2000, Seismic Charge
Chose to take the risk at PS6 without VI. With IG being so reliant on his Sloops and Kturns, combined with the stress-meta (FU stresshogs), I was finding them constantly being denied actions. However, with Wired they at least can turn that negative into a positive and really make the most of those dice rolls on attack and defense. Once Tractor Beams are released, I'll prolly drop that Seismic and stick TBs on each one.

I used B/C last night with sensors, AT, mangler, predator, dampeners, and tractor beam. Tractor beam pushed three ships onto asteroids and almost positioned another to fly off the board. For 1 pt TB is a nasty little opportunity cost that was surprisingly effective.
